你查询的IP:[122.51.200.152]  地理位置:中国–上海–上海

最新查询59.172.135.112 125.96.197.250 120.70.203.110 218.192.67.141 119.254.56.244 119.42.189.145 121.255.61.244 221.192.19.180 123.253.28.113 122.51.200.152 59.64.179.178 116.213.128.61 122.112.119.45 221.8.40.117 124.242.65.41 203.175.128.218 119.80.75.203 202.164.25.81 60.247.96.199 58.30.134.192 118.24.169.252 210.79.224.16 118.230.22.106 121.55.112.247 121.52.160.170 202.130.224.72 60.208.6.10 210.79.64.66 58.128.253.148 202.4.252.28 203.93.161.171